Nonetheless, knowledge of these ideas is essential to understanding the games and policies of gaming:

ACTION: Any style of wager.

ALL-IN: In poker, all-in means a player has risked all of their chips into the pot. A second pot is created for the gamblers with additional money.

ALL-UP: To wager on several horses in the same race.

ANTE: A poker phrase for placing a necessary figure of money into the pot just beforeevery hand starts.

BRING-IN: A necessary wager in seven-card stud made by the gambler displaying the smallest value card.

BUST: You do not win; As in vingt-et-un, when a player’s cards are valued over 21.

BUY-IN: The minimal amount of chips required to enroll in a match or event.

CALL: As in poker, when a bet is the same as a prior made wager.

CHECK: In poker, to stay in the match without betting. This is acceptable only if no other gamblers bet in that round.

CLOSING A BET: As in spread wagering, meaning to lay a bet on par with but converse of the opening wager.

COLUMN BET: To wager on any of the three columns of a roulette table.

COME BET: In craps, close to a pass-line bet, but made after the player has ascertained her number.

COME-OUT ROLL: A crapshooters first toss to arrive at a point, or the initial roll after a point is achieved.

COVERALL: A bingo term, which means to blanket all the spots on a bingo card.

CRAPPING OUT: In craps, to roll a 2, three or 12 is an automatic loss on the come-out toss.

DAILY DOUBLE: To select the winners of the initial two matches of the tournament.

DOWN BET: To wager that the outcome of an event will be lower than the smallest end of the quote on a spread bet, also referred to as a "sell".

DOZEN BET: In roulette, to bet on any of 3 groups of 12 numbers, 1-twelve, etc.

EACH WAY BET: A sports gamble, indicating to wager on a team or player to win or position in an event.

EVEN MONEY BET: A bet that pays out the same sum as bet, ( 1:1 ).

EXACTA: laying odds that two horses in an event will finish in the absolute same assignment as the wager – also referred to as a " Perfecta ".

FIVE-NUMBER LINE BET: In roulette, a wager made on a block of 5 numbers, for instance 1-2-3-0, and 00.
